Great question! Let’s break it down into a few areas:
A lot of the techniques used are the same, but Leather comes from the skin, or hide, of an animal (usually cow, sheep, or goat in my products). Vegan Leather is a material called PolyUrethane (PU for short) and doesn’t rely on animal skins to create the product.
Leather, when maintained, will last a lifetime or more. Vegan Leather can break down over time.
